X141 NJN is a 2000 Jeep Cherokee Classic Auto in Black with a 3,960c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 2000 Jeep Cherokee Classic Auto models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.4% with a typical mileage of 88,422 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Jeep Cherokee Classic Auto f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 190 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X141 NJN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jeep Cherokee Classic Auto typ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 26 years old, this Jeep Cherokee Classic Auto is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
